For those living in Minter, Virtual IOPs offer numerous advantages. These programs typically require 9-20 hours of structured therapy each week, allowing participants to engage in life-changing treatments without the burden of commuting. The evidence-based therapies available, such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T), are designed to effectively address a variety of mental health issues, including anxiety, depression, and PTSD, making them a beneficial resource for the community.
Getting started with a Virtual IOP in Minter is straightforward. Licensed therapists and counselors are ready to provide individualized support through HIPAA-compliant video conferencing platforms. Programs generally schedule sessions 3-5 days a week, each lasting 3-4 hours.
